Dozens killed and wounded in Israeli air strike on Jabalia refugee camp

Thirty Palestinians were killed and dozens injured today as a result of Israeli shelling in areas in the northern Gaza Strip, where the shelling targeted a food distribution center in Jabalia refugee camp in the northern Gaza Strip, according to medics in the area.

The Palestinian news agency reported that Israeli warplanes bombed two schools housing displaced people and several homes in the Jabalia refugee camp in the northern Gaza Strip, killing 20 Palestinians and wounding others, while artillery shelled a gathering of Palestinians inside an aid distribution center in the camp, killing at least 10, and wounding more than 40, with the difficulty of ambulances reaching the center and helping the wounded.

Eight people were killed when Israeli warplanes bombed areas in Sheikh Radwan neighborhood west of Gaza City on Monday evening.

The Ministry of Health in Gaza Strip said that Israeli artillery shelling hit an UNRWA food center, known as the “camp supply center.”

Local sources indicated that the shelling coincided with a gathering of mostly women and the elderly, who were waiting for flour.

On his part, The United Nations renewed its call for an immediate ceasefire in the Gaza Strip. “A ceasefire is necessary and indispensable to stop this destruction,” it stressed.
